WebMar 20, 2024 · While tax reliefs reduce your chargeable income, tax deductions reduce the amount of your aggregate income (the sum of your total income for the entire year). These are the deductions allowed for YA 2024, on an individual claim: 1) Donations to charities, sports activities, and approved funds/institutions. WebMar 25, 2024 · But there’s a much easier way to register: online, through e-Daftar. After registering, LHDN will email you with your income tax number within 3 working days. Alternatively, you can either check online via e-Daftar, or give LHDN a call at 03-89133800. To register or log in to your e-Filing for the first time, you’ll need a PIN provided by ...
